MEMO — Spare Parts Run to Kestrel Point

Heads up: the pump seals and filter kits for the Kestrel Point relay station finally landed. They're boxed up in the store room, shelf four, marked with orange tape. Grayvale Couriers is doing the run Wednesday — long drive, so they'll collect early, around 7. Make sure the packing list is inside the lid. At pick-up, please pass along the following instruction.

dispatch memo: the lamwyn fenwyn courier leaves the wenir ledger at gate 7175 under passcode 822969

**Mgmt Meeting Minutes — Retiring the Brightline Range**

Quick recap for sales leads at Fenholt Supplies: we agreed to retire the Brightline fixture range by year-end. Remaining stock moves to clearance pricing next month, and accounts on standing orders get migrated to the Lumetta range. Trade-in incentives were approved in principle. The confidential note on next steps sits just below.

board note of bajof-bajeg: The pricing group signed off on a budget of $13.4 million for Project Sildor. The renewal with Lamixek Holdings closes at $48.9 million a year, 49 percent above the last contract.

Hi, welcome to the TideLine on-call rotation. The tide-table widget pulls predictions from the Moonharbor service every six hours and caches them locally; most pages you'll see are stale-cache warnings, not outages. When reviewing fixes, check that the cache TTL and the station-offset table stay in sync, since mismatches cause the off-by-one-hour bug we saw last quarter. Escalation steps, dashboards, and the station mapping are all kept on the internal page here.

operations page: https://jenkins.zemvarcloud.local/job/merge_requests/repo/build/73930b4b30f0a8ed